Tactics are simple. BIG THINGS!!!!! Big things that go boom, Big things that go Zoom and other big things that make other things go Boom! Hopefully all the while distracting my opponent from A. Picking on my poor Kroot, and B. Making sure theyre slow to realise the Threat that 10 Warp Spiders with Stealth/Shrouding can be.
Ever since i saw the Eldar were coming with Jetpack infantry i wondered if there was a decent combo there and i think this is it. Shadowsun and 10 Spiders. Not as fast as Spiders on their own however what the Spiders Lose in being unable to Warp Jump, they gain in Shadowsuns Warlord trait. Not to mention a 4+ Cover save in the Open!
Top that off with my personal favourite unit of WraithScythes with their Psyker Buddy in one of them there new fandangled Wave Serpents and i think it could do well.
The Knights build is open for consideration. I built him Combat because its what the Force is missing more than anything. I could save some points and go Bare Bones, or even more expensive, but i dont rate any of his main weapons. The WraithCannon is just a S10 gun, and 2 shots can easily miss where as with 3 Ion Accelerators, i dont think i need to bother with the Sun Cannon.
